Understanding the 'AFK' Misconception

When gamers ask 'how much water for AFK GamerSupps?' there is a common misunderstanding at play. The "AFK" product line from GamerSupps is not an energy supplement for all-day gaming sessions where you are 'Away From Keyboard'. Instead, the AFK line is a sleep aid, formulated with ingredients like magnesium and apigenin to help you wind down before bed. This is crucial because the recommended mixing instructions and consumption timing are completely different from their standard energy drinks.

Mixing the AFK Sleep Aid

As specified on product pages, the AFK sleep complex is designed for immediate consumption, typically 30 minutes before sleep. Leaving it to sit for extended periods is not recommended, and some users have even noted changes in color and consistency overnight.

  • Standard Preparation: Mix one scoop of AFK powder with 300–400 ml of cold water.
  • Customization: You can adjust the water slightly for taste preference, but it should be consumed quickly after preparation for optimal effect and taste.

Mixing GamerSupps for Extended 'AFK' Gaming Sessions

For long gaming sessions where you need sustained focus and hydration, you should be using one of GamerSupps' standard GG Energy or Caffeine-Free products, not the AFK line. These are designed for energy and hydration without the sleep-inducing components.

Standard GG Energy & Caffeine-Free

  • Standard Preparation: The official recommendation for most GG products is one scoop mixed with 250 ml (approximately 8 ounces) of cold water. This provides a balanced flavor and effective dose of nutrients.
  • For All-Day Hydration (Diluted Mix): Many community members prefer a more diluted mix for sipping throughout the day, which also helps manage caffeine intake. A popular ratio is two scoops per liter (approximately 34 oz). This keeps the flavor palatable without being overly sweet or strong. Using a large, insulated tumbler for this purpose is ideal, as it keeps your drink cold and enjoyable over a long period.

The Role of Insulated Containers and Ice

For a true 'AFK' experience with standard GG, proper temperature is key. An insulated cup or shaker bottle is a game-changer. Not only does it keep your drink refreshingly cold for hours, but adding ice can also serve a practical purpose. As one Reddit user pointed out, melting ice naturally dilutes the mix over time, giving you a slightly larger and less intense drink.
